The NEOS post-market clinical follow-up study is undertaken to demonstrate the safety and clinical performance of E-vita OPEN NEO in the treatment of aneurysm or dissection in the ascending aorta, aortic arch and descending thoracic aorta.

In this study, patients will be observed who receive an E-vita OPEN NEO implant for the treatment of thoracic aneurysm or acute or chronic thoracic dissection. E-vita OPEN NEO will be implanted according to the instructions for use and at the discretion of the treating physician.
Participating physicians will provide their observations collected during routine care for patients treated with E-vita OPEN NEO. Written informed consent, specifically allowing the use of clinical records for this observational study, will be obtained from every patient prior to data collection.
The period of data collection will be approximately 60 months from the date of intervention for each patient. Source data verification will be performed on 100% of the patients; data from all the visits that was provided in the database will be reviewed and verified against existing source documents. Complete DICOM image files of the CT scans will be sent to the CoreLab for independent evaluation. All adverse events defined prior to study start will be adjudicated by the Clinical Event Committee (CEC).

Inclusion criteria
Patient has aortic sinus, or ascending aorta, or aortic arch, or descending aorta diameter ≥ 5.5 cm.
Patient has aorta diameter < 5.5 cm and a growth rate of ≥ 0.5 cm / year. Patient has ascending aorta diameter ≥ 4.5 cm and requires an aortic valve repair or replacement.
Patient has clinical signs of abdominal or peripheral malperfusion.
Patient has a suitable distal sealing area in the descending thoracic aorta proximal to the celiac trunk.
